Skip to main content

Search hotels in Oslo Beach

Enter your dates to see the latest prices and deals for Oslo Beach hotels

Popular hotels in Oslo Beach

Check out our top picks in Oslo Beach

Filter by:

Star rating
Review score

Beach View

Oslo Beach

Situated within 1.8 km of Oslo Beach and 5.1 km of Port Shepstone Country Club, Beach View features rooms with air conditioning and a private bathroom in Oslo Beach.

W
Wendy Nikelwa
From
South Africa
Property it’s very clean and I would like to book again😍
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 125 reviews
Price from
US$54.59
1 night, 2 adults

Umthunzi Hotel and Conference

Umtentweni (Near Oslo Beach)

Umthunzi Hotel & Conference | Award-Winning 3-Star Hotel Proud recipient of multiple accolades—including the prestigious Top Vendor Award for “Best Coastal Wedding Venue” and the Readers’ Choice Award...

G
Gugu
From
South Africa
Breakfast was nice, my room was clean.
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 420 reviews
Price from
US$103.72
1 night, 2 adults

Bayside Taj Hotel

Port Shepstone (Near Oslo Beach)

Situated in Port Shepstone, within 2.9 km of Port Shepstone Beach and 5 km of Port Shepstone Country Club, Bayside Taj Hotel features accommodation with a bar and free WiFi throughout the property as...

M
MissB
From
South Africa
Toilet brush should be available Complimentary breakfast
Scored out of 10, guest rating 7.8
Good - What previous guests thought, 827 reviews
Price from
US$44.52
1 night, 2 adults

The Notebook Hotel

Port Shepstone (Near Oslo Beach)

Located in Port Shepstone, 2 km from Umtentweni Public Beach, The Notebook Hotel provides accommodation with an outdoor swimming pool, free private parking, a garden and a private beach area.

S
Shamos
From
South Africa
I absolutely adored the staff and the room and the place itself. It's so incredibly calming and beautifully appointed.
Scored out of 10, guest rating 7.4
Good - What previous guests thought, 13 reviews
Price from
US$72.79
1 night, 2 adults

NoniSands Guesthouse

Uvongo Beach (Near Oslo Beach)

Set in Uvongo Beach, 200 metres from Manaba Beach, NoniSands Guesthouse offers accommodation with an outdoor swimming pool, free private parking, a garden and a terrace.

M
Mdlangaso
From
South Africa
The facilities were very clean. Peaceful and quiet place 😊. Princess is such an awesome host. Enjoyed every moment. The food was👌.
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 116 reviews
Price from
US$60.50
1 night, 2 adults

Peace Cottage

Port Shepstone (Near Oslo Beach)

Located in Port Shepstone in the KwaZulu-Natal region, Peace Cottage has a patio and garden views.

M
Muhammad ismail
From
United Kingdom
The views the location. Fully equipped
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 146 reviews
Price from
US$109.18
1 night, 2 adults

Tropical Beach Boutique Guesthouse

Shelly Beach (Near Oslo Beach)

Situated in Shelly Beach in the KwaZulu-Natal Region, 1.2 km from South Coast Mall, Tropical Beach Boutique Guesthouse boasts an outdoor pool and a private beach area.

J
Jaime
From
Spain
The accommodation is AMAZING, a very well kept tropical resort, even has a tree full of life with about 150 years old!!!! The rooms are very comfortable and have everything and it's literally right on the beach! And although we loved the whole infrastructure, the best of all was Andre, the Manager, he gave us all the confidence in the world and helped us to find everything we wanted to do there, following his advice we spent three amazing days. And if that wasn't enough, my partner got sick on an excursion, and when we arrived, he helped me to look after her and always made sure that everything was ok. I WOULD DEFINITELY COME BACK AGAIN AND AGAIN TO THE SAME PLACE. It only remains for me to thank you for the perfect stay we had.
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 163 reviews
Price from
US$100.08
1 night, 2 adults

92 Laguna La Crete

Uvongo Beach (Near Oslo Beach)

Situated in Uvongo Beach in the KwaZulu-Natal region, 92 Laguna La Crete has a balcony.

H
Henry Kwidini
From
South Africa
The place is clean, the interior decor is on point, everything from blankets to towels branded. Comes, with a Beach View and you can literally walk from your room to the beach which is private and there is a lagoon with a waterfall. Wow, the place exceeded my expectations by a wide margin, definitely coming back soon!
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 6 reviews
Price from
US$58
1 night, 2 adults

The Lookout Guesthouse

Uvongo Beach (Near Oslo Beach)

Located in Uvongo Beach and only less than 1 km from Uvongo Beach, The Lookout Guesthouse provides accommodation with sea views, free WiFi and free private parking.

L
Lerato
From
South Africa
The property is very clean, spectacular and quiet.
Scored out of 10, guest rating 9.9
Exceptional - What previous guests thought, 9 reviews
Price from
US$93.41
1 night, 2 adults

Topanga 11, Seaside Bliss!

Uvongo Beach (Near Oslo Beach)

Set in Uvongo Beach, Topanga 11, Seaside Bliss! offers accommodation with private pool, free WiFi and free private parking for guests who drive.

R
Rodney
From
South Africa
Easy to locate the property. The owner was extremely friendly and understanding. Very neat and tidy flat. Beach is a walk away. Won’t hesitate going back.
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 13 reviews
Price from
US$58.96
1 night, 2 adults
See all hotels in and around Oslo Beach

Oslo Beach – 1 hotel or place to stay

Filter by:

Star rating
Review score

Beach View

Oslo Beach

Situated within 1.8 km of Oslo Beach and 5.1 km of Port Shepstone Country Club, Beach View features rooms with air conditioning and a private bathroom in Oslo Beach.

W
Wendy Nikelwa
From
South Africa
Property it’s very clean and I would like to book again😍
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 125 reviews
Price from
US$54.59
1 night, 2 adults

Umthunzi Hotel and Conference

Umtentweni (Near Oslo Beach)

Umthunzi Hotel & Conference | Award-Winning 3-Star Hotel Proud recipient of multiple accolades—including the prestigious Top Vendor Award for “Best Coastal Wedding Venue” and the Readers’ Choice Award...

G
Gugu
From
South Africa
Breakfast was nice, my room was clean.
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 420 reviews
Price from
US$103.72
1 night, 2 adults

Bayside Taj Hotel

Port Shepstone (Near Oslo Beach)

Situated in Port Shepstone, within 2.9 km of Port Shepstone Beach and 5 km of Port Shepstone Country Club, Bayside Taj Hotel features accommodation with a bar and free WiFi throughout the property as...

M
MissB
From
South Africa
Toilet brush should be available Complimentary breakfast
Scored out of 10, guest rating 7.8
Good - What previous guests thought, 827 reviews
Price from
US$44.52
1 night, 2 adults

The Notebook Hotel

Port Shepstone (Near Oslo Beach)

Located in Port Shepstone, 2 km from Umtentweni Public Beach, The Notebook Hotel provides accommodation with an outdoor swimming pool, free private parking, a garden and a private beach area.

S
Shamos
From
South Africa
I absolutely adored the staff and the room and the place itself. It's so incredibly calming and beautifully appointed.
Scored out of 10, guest rating 7.4
Good - What previous guests thought, 13 reviews
Price from
US$72.79
1 night, 2 adults

NoniSands Guesthouse

Uvongo Beach (Near Oslo Beach)

Set in Uvongo Beach, 200 metres from Manaba Beach, NoniSands Guesthouse offers accommodation with an outdoor swimming pool, free private parking, a garden and a terrace.

M
Mdlangaso
From
South Africa
The facilities were very clean. Peaceful and quiet place 😊. Princess is such an awesome host. Enjoyed every moment. The food was👌.
Scored out of 10, guest rating 9.0
Superb - What previous guests thought, 116 reviews
Price from
US$60.50
1 night, 2 adults

Peace Cottage

Port Shepstone (Near Oslo Beach)

Located in Port Shepstone in the KwaZulu-Natal region, Peace Cottage has a patio and garden views.

M
Muhammad ismail
From
United Kingdom
The views the location. Fully equipped
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 146 reviews
Price from
US$109.18
1 night, 2 adults

Tropical Beach Boutique Guesthouse

Shelly Beach (Near Oslo Beach)

Situated in Shelly Beach in the KwaZulu-Natal Region, 1.2 km from South Coast Mall, Tropical Beach Boutique Guesthouse boasts an outdoor pool and a private beach area.

J
Jaime
From
Spain
The accommodation is AMAZING, a very well kept tropical resort, even has a tree full of life with about 150 years old!!!! The rooms are very comfortable and have everything and it's literally right on the beach! And although we loved the whole infrastructure, the best of all was Andre, the Manager, he gave us all the confidence in the world and helped us to find everything we wanted to do there, following his advice we spent three amazing days. And if that wasn't enough, my partner got sick on an excursion, and when we arrived, he helped me to look after her and always made sure that everything was ok. I WOULD DEFINITELY COME BACK AGAIN AND AGAIN TO THE SAME PLACE. It only remains for me to thank you for the perfect stay we had.
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 163 reviews
Price from
US$100.08
1 night, 2 adults

92 Laguna La Crete

Uvongo Beach (Near Oslo Beach)

Situated in Uvongo Beach in the KwaZulu-Natal region, 92 Laguna La Crete has a balcony.

H
Henry Kwidini
From
South Africa
The place is clean, the interior decor is on point, everything from blankets to towels branded. Comes, with a Beach View and you can literally walk from your room to the beach which is private and there is a lagoon with a waterfall. Wow, the place exceeded my expectations by a wide margin, definitely coming back soon!
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 6 reviews
Price from
US$58
1 night, 2 adults

The Lookout Guesthouse

Uvongo Beach (Near Oslo Beach)

Located in Uvongo Beach and only less than 1 km from Uvongo Beach, The Lookout Guesthouse provides accommodation with sea views, free WiFi and free private parking.

L
Lerato
From
South Africa
The property is very clean, spectacular and quiet.
Scored out of 10, guest rating 9.9
Exceptional - What previous guests thought, 9 reviews
Price from
US$93.41
1 night, 2 adults

Topanga 11, Seaside Bliss!

Uvongo Beach (Near Oslo Beach)

Set in Uvongo Beach, Topanga 11, Seaside Bliss! offers accommodation with private pool, free WiFi and free private parking for guests who drive.

R
Rodney
From
South Africa
Easy to locate the property. The owner was extremely friendly and understanding. Very neat and tidy flat. Beach is a walk away. Won’t hesitate going back.
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 13 reviews
Price from
US$58.96
1 night, 2 adults
See all hotels in and around Oslo Beach

Most booked hotels in Oslo Beach and surroundings in the past month

See all

Popular with guests booking hotels in Port Shepstone

Scored out of 10, guest rating 7.8
Good - What previous guests thought, 830 reviews

Popular with guests booking hotels in Umtentweni

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 420 reviews

Popular with guests booking hotels in Port Shepstone

Scored out of 10, guest rating 7.3
Good - What previous guests thought, 4 reviews

Popular with guests booking hotels in Port Shepstone

Scored out of 10, guest rating 7.4
Good - What previous guests thought, 13 reviews

Popular with guests booking hotels in Umtentweni

Popular with guests booking hotels in Port Shepstone

Popular with guests booking hotels in Port Shepstone

Popular with guests booking hotels in Port Shepstone

Popular with guests booking hotels in Port Shepstone

Popular with guests booking hotels in Margate

Budget hotels in Oslo Beach and nearby

Scored out of 10, guest rating 7.7
Good - What previous guests thought, 17 reviews

Boasting a garden, private pool and garden views, The Beach House is situated in Port Shepstone. This beachfront property offers access to a patio, free private parking and free WiFi.

From US$103.12 per night
Scored out of 10, guest rating 7.9
Good - What previous guests thought, 186 reviews

Featuring an outdoor swimming pool and hot tub, this property offers self-catering and hotel accommodation at just 30 metres from Oslo Beach. Port Shepstone is a 2-minute drive away.

From US$81.89 per night
Scored out of 10, guest rating 7.8
Good - What previous guests thought, 830 reviews

Situated in Port Shepstone, within 2.9 km of Port Shepstone Beach and 5 km of Port Shepstone Country Club, Bayside Taj Hotel features accommodation with a bar and free WiFi throughout the property as...

From US$55.32 per night
Scored out of 10, guest rating 10
Exceptional - What previous guests thought, 1 review

Set in Shelly Beach, a few steps from Shelly Beach and 10 km from Port Shepstone Country Club, Port Royale Shelly Beach Guest House offers an outdoor swimming pool and air conditioning.

Scored out of 10, guest rating 10
Exceptional - What previous guests thought, 3 reviews

Offering a garden and inner courtyard view, 567 on Strelitzia - Shelly Beach is set in Margate, 18 km from Southbroom Golf Club and 19 km from Port Shepstone Country Club.

From US$54.59 per night

Situated in Margate, 100 metres from Shelly Beach and 13 km from Port Shepstone Country Club, Eagle Wings offers a bar and air conditioning.

Scored out of 10, guest rating 6.4
Pleasant - What previous guests thought, 23 reviews

Set within 200 metres of Shelly Beach and 13 km of Port Shepstone Country Club, Zakuza Shelly Sea View Lodge offers rooms with air conditioning and a private bathroom in Margate.

From US$43.67 per night
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 55 reviews

Featuring accommodation with a private pool, sea view and a patio, Seaview Self Catering is located in Port Shepstone.

From US$116.01 per night

Best hotels with breakfast in Oslo Beach and nearby

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 78 reviews

Stephan's Guest House is a recently renovated guest house in Port Shepstone, where guests can makes the most of its pool with a view, water sports facilities and garden.

From US$78.85 per night
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 186 reviews

Royston Hall Historical Guesthouse in Umtentweni provides adults-only accommodation with pool with a view, a garden and barbecue facilities.

From US$90.98 per night
Scored out of 10, guest rating 8.3
Very good - What previous guests thought, 50 reviews

Umdlalo Lodge is set in Port Shepstone, 6.9 km from Port Shepstone Country Club, 25 km from Mbumbazi Nature Reserve, and 29 km from Southbroom Golf Club.

From US$78.85 per night
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 420 reviews

Umthunzi Hotel & Conference | Award-Winning 3-Star Hotel Proud recipient of multiple accolades—including the prestigious Top Vendor Award for “Best Coastal Wedding Venue” and the Readers’ Choice...

From US$90.98 per night
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 28 reviews

Located in Umtentweni, 8 On Eagle Bed & Breakfast Room 3 provides accommodation with a private pool, a patio and pool views.

From US$60.05 per night
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 41 reviews

Set in Port Shepstone, 8 On Eagle Bed & Breakfast Room 4 offers accommodation with a private pool, a patio and garden views.

From US$54.59 per night
Scored out of 10, guest rating 9.5
Exceptional - What previous guests thought, 43 reviews

Set in Port Shepstone, 8 On Eagle Bed & Breakfast Room 2 offers accommodation with a private pool, a patio and pool views. This property offers access to a terrace, free private parking and free WiFi.

From US$60.05 per night
Scored out of 10, guest rating 9.7
Exceptional - What previous guests thought, 9 reviews

Located in Umtentweni and only 1.3 km from Umtentweni Public Beach, 8 On Eagle Bed & Breakfast Room 1 provides accommodation with sea views, free WiFi and free private parking.

From US$78.85 per night